Old TV movie

Today, I watched an old tv movie from the early 1970s entitled "Terror on the Beach". The story concerns a family of middle class campers headed by Dennis Weaver who are harassed and then attacked by a Charles Manson type group. I found the movie interesting because it is similar to what my parents believed at the time. Many from the World War Two generation thought that the various counter culture youth groups of the late 1960s and early 1970s were drug- crazed and dangerous. In the end, Dennis Weaver, fights the leader of the hippy family and restores order. You can just see millions of graying men in their living rooms cheering on Dennis Weaver. Give those punks a good beating and things will get back to normal. In real life, it didn't quite work out that way.

Like it or not, Hippy culture-The drugs, promiscuity, music, hair styles, and even the fashion has become integrated into mainstream American culture.
